New hospitality academy opens in Muscat

 
MUSCAT: Muscat Hospitality Academy (MHA), launched by Heart of Hospitality, opens its first Vocational Education and Training/VET by EHL licenced training institute in Oman. MHA, in partnership with EHL Group, Switzerland, sets the standards in excellence for vocational education and training in hospitality, offering the next generation an exciting opportunity to build their career in the hospitality industry, both within the Sultanate of Oman and globally. The academy will initially focus on various level programmes in four key specialisations — culinary, service, rooms and hotel administration. The programmes are designed to cover almost 80 per cent of the job skill demand of the industry. All curriculum and course materials are developed in Switzerland by the EHL Group and delivered by VET by EHL approved industry experts.

“We are very proud of the fact that MHA has already been very well received by the hospitality sector in the Sultanate of Oman, with commitment from many 4 to 5-Star brands, which includes more than 370 employment opportunities for Omani nationals upon successful completion of our VET by EHL programmes. We are presenting a fantastic opportunity for Omanis who will receive unique world-class vocational educational training by hospitality industry experts, incorporating rigorous practical Internships to ensure that they are equipped to be ready for the job market from Day 1 of graduation “explained Xia Cai, Managing Partner for Heart of Hospitality.
